Rick Webb Photo

Rick Webb

Chief Executive Officer
Watco Companies

Pittsburg, Kansas

A rail transportation service provider, Watco started in 1983 with one location and a handful of good people.  Today, the Watco team of 2,850 serves customers in 26 states, Canada, and Australia. Watco is one of the largest shortline railroad operators in the United States, serving more than 1,300 customers on 4,500 miles of track on 27 shortlines.  Watco is also the largest car-repair shop service provider in the United States and, additionally, provides contract switching, terminal, and port services.

Chief Executive Officer since 1998, Rick Webb's primary responsibility has been the growth and strategic direction of Watco.  Prior to becoming CEO, Rick learned the business by working alongside his father Dick Webb, founder of Watco. Rick held various management and leadership positions within Watco, including operations, purchasing, marketing, accounting, and financial management. 

An active participant in efforts to improve rail transportation for customers, Rick serves on the Board of Directors for both the Association of American Railroads and the National Industrial Transportation League.  He is also a vigorous supporter of his community and an advocate for Pittsburg State University and many local schools and community organizations.  He is member of the Pittsburg State University Foundation Board of Trustees, Community National Bank's (CNB) Advisory Board of Directors, and US Bank's Market Board of Directors. He earned a BS in physics from Pittsburg State University.
